May is Brain Tumour Awareness Month so in this season we bring you some stories focused on brain tumours with medical experts, the survivors and those we have sadly lost.
Dr Taffy, Ire;ands 1st Female Paediatric Neurosurgeon is our first guest this season.
A mother of 3 we talk openly about why she is so committed to her work, to her patients and to fighting childhood cancer.
We talk about the intensity of surgery, the team around her, how she has had to learn when to detach from emotion to become super focused on her skills as a surgeon while allowing her playful spirit to connect with the children under her care.
